Streamlining Vessel Engineering: The PV Elite Inventor Plugin

The PV Elite Inventor Plugin is a specialized, free utility from Hexagon (Intergraph) that enables direct, two-way integration between PV Elite (pressure vessel design/analysis software) and Autodesk Inventor (3D modeling software). It allows engineers to import detailed PV Elite models (.pvdb/.pvtp) into Inventor to create 3D CAD models, General Arrangement (GA) drawings, and detailed fabrication drawings while retaining critical analysis data. Automatic Hole Cutting: Automatically generates nozzle openings in the cylindrical shells during the import process. Data Preservation (I-Properties): Retains detailed information from the PV Elite input/analysis files, such as shell lengths, material names, densities, and PBU analysis data, which can be viewed in Inventor's "I-properties". Visualization and Editing: Adds a "PVE color visibility options" menu, allowing users to color-code components and toggle the visibility of specific parts to inspect internal structures.
